Abstract

PROCEDIMIENTO PARA PRODUCIR UN PEPTIDO QUE COMPRENDE UN PEPTIDO DE EXO-SEN/AL UNIDO OPERATIVAMENTE A UNA PROTEINA DESEADA.COMPRENDE: A) PROPORCIONAR UNA SECUENCIA DE ADN QUE CODIFICA UN PEPTIDO DE EXO-SEN/AL DE TIPO SILVESTRE QUE TIENE UNA REGION FACILITADORA CON UN RESTO DE CISTEINA, PARA FORMAR LIPOPROTEINA LIGADA A LA MEMBRANA; B) ALTERAR A LA SECUENCIA DE ADN, PARA OBTENER QUE UN PEPTIDO DE EXO-SEN/AL CODIFICADO POR LA SECUENCIA DE ADN ALTERADA QUE CONTIENE UN AMINOACIDO X DISTINTO DE LA CISTEINA EN LA REGION FACILITADORA, NO FORME LIPOPROTEINA LIGADA A LA MEMBRANA; C) UNIR LA SECUENCIA DE ADN DE (A) A LA SECUENCIA DE ADN ALTERADA QUE CODIFICA UN PEPTIDO DE EXO-SEN/AL ALTERADO PARA CONSERVAR AL AMINOACIDO X Y A LA SECUENCIA DE ADN DE (A); D) TRANSFORMAR UNA CELULA PROCARIOTICA CON UN VECTOR REPLICABLE QUE CONTIENE LAS SECUENCIAS DE ADN UNIDAS DE LAS OPERACIONES (A), (B) Y (C); Y E) DESARROLLAR A LA CELULA PROCARIOTICA TRANSFORMADA EN UN MEDIO NUTRIENTE ADECUADO, PARA OBTENER UN PEPTIDO.
